Ghana’s battle with illegal mining, popularly known as galamsey, has become a defining issue of governance. Rivers once used for drinking and irrigation are now poisoned with mercury, forests are cleared in the dead of night, and communities are left struggling with the health consequences of toxic metals in their food and water.
